How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Mapleton?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Mapleton Studio Apartments | $966 | $640 | $1,260 |
Mapleton 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,068 | $595 | $2,195 |
Mapleton 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,377 | $720 | $3,905 |
Mapleton 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,697 | $895 | $2,500 |
Mapleton 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,332 | $1,405 | $3,300 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Gated Mapleton Apartments
What is the Cheapest Gated apartment in Mapleton?
Currently the most affordable Gated Apartment in Mapleton is at Carlton Place listed at $640.
How much is the average rent for a Gated Mapleton Apartment?
The average rent for a Gated Apartment in Mapleton is $1,130.
What is the largest Gated Mapleton Apartment for rent?
Today's Gated apartment with the most square footage in Mapleton is a 1,565 square feet unit starting from $1,025 at Amber Crossing Apartments.
What is the average size for Mapleton Gated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Gated rental in Mapleton is currently at 637 sq ft.
